I bought a new replacement horn pad as mine had some crud on it that I could not remove. Easy, straight-forward install....2 screws behind the steering wheel; no airbag to contend with, etc.
After I installed it, my horn chirps when turning the wheel at certain points (sort of like vehicles where you hit the lock button twice on a remote). I moved the horn contacts around and re-installed; no change. Finally, I even removed the rubber pad itself off of the metal "frame" it's on, swapped it to my old "frame", installed the cruise buttons, etc. (I figured maybe it was the new assembly). It still does it every once in awhile.
Seems like some contacts are touching at a certain point in which the wheel is turned. Any ideas?
